Mission Story Summary

  • The Hall of Blessings mission story shares how God used a construction project in Kenya to influence lives through prayer, kindness, and Christian example.
  • A new multipurpose hall was built at Mwata Adventist School for Deaf Children through the support of mission offerings.
  • The project included a modern kitchen and dining area for the children.
  • Before this, meals were cooked over an open fire, and the children ate outside in the open field.
  • Elijah, a Seventh-day Adventist, supervised the construction work.
  • Every morning, he gathered the workers for prayer before the day began.
  • Through these simple moments, the workers saw that this project was different.
  • Most of the workers were not Adventists, but they respected the spirit of prayer, order, and kindness at the site.
  • During the entire construction period, no accidents or injuries were reported.
  • No building materials were stolen, and the work continued peacefully from beginning to end.
  • Elijah believed God’s protecting hand was over the project.
  • This reminded everyone that prayer is not only part of worship but also part of daily work and mission.
  • Some workers came drunk on the first day, but Elijah kindly explained that they could not work in that condition.
  • The next day they returned sober because they wanted to remain part of the project.
  • As the weeks passed, workers began encouraging one another to stay away from alcohol.
  • Through this mission project, Christian influence became visible in practical ways.
  • The construction site became more than a workplace.
  • God used it to teach discipline, respect, and better choices.
  • Elijah hoped the workers would not only help build a hall but also begin building better lives for themselves and their families.

The Project We Are Contributing To

  • A previous Thirteenth Sabbath Offering helped build the new hall, kitchen, dining area, and dormitory at Mwata Adventist School for Deaf Children.
  • These facilities are improving the lives of the children and creating a better place for learning and worship.
  • This quarter’s offering will help build new classrooms at Merisho Advent Community Nursery School near Nairobi.
  • Through this project, more children will learn about Jesus in a safe and caring environment.
